The next controversial issue that has come to my attention was the planning of a 'Compton Cookout' thrown by the Pi Kappa Alpha Fraternity of University of California, San Diego. These guys thought it would be funny to throw a ghetto themed party to mock the celebration of Black History Month! The following is the invitation that was posted on Facebook:

The 'good' news is that action has been taken by the university to make sure that this party does not happen. They also made an effort to have a teach-in to show the faculty and students at UC how such things impact the community.
